Founded in Seoul in 2019, SEMIFIVE is basing its foundation on Korea’s semiconductor design competency that was amassed for more than 20 years. With expertise spanning front-end to back-end design, SEMIFIVE has become the fastest growing silicon design company that offers the most comprehensive design solutions. SEMIFIVE’s core business is its innovative SoC Platform that enables low-cost and high-efficiency SoC design, and also provides full turnkey silicon design services for global customers.

As the cost of developing an SoC and the demand for customized silicon continue to grow rapidly, SEMIFIVE’s SoC Platform plays a critical role in turning innovative ideas into silicon. SEMIFIVE works closely with global technology leaders and is rapidly emerging as The New Global Hub of Custom Silicon.

Semifive India Design Centre, headquartered in Bangalore, is a rapidly growing capability centre responsible for delivering complex, multi-node SoC programs for global customers across the US, Europe, and Asia. The India team owns front-end through back-end execution, including RTL, STA, synthesis, physical design, and signoff for turnkey silicon programs.
